Row 1. The Lockheed Constellation was the last of the prop driven airliners Still one of the most beautiful aircraft ever designed with its curvasious fuselage and tripple rudders,.

Row 2. In comparison the Catalina to some was an ungainly looking aircraft. but effective. On the right is a Seahawk climbing.

Row 3. The relatively equal proportions of the Folland Gnat and the Supermarine Spitfire can be seen in the left photo. On the right is the Folland, a trainer from the 50s and 60s.
